單片機解密過程有哪些?
芯片上面的塑料可以用小刀揭開,芯片周圍的環氧樹脂可以用濃硝酸腐蝕掉。熱的濃硝酸會溶解掉芯片封裝而不會影響芯片及連線。該過程一般
在非常干燥的條件下進行,因為水的存在可能會侵蝕已暴露的鋁線連接 (這就可能造成解密失敗)。
清洗芯片
1.接著在超聲池里先用丙酮清洗該芯片以除去殘余硝酸,并浸泡。
2.尋找保護熔絲的位置并破壞
3.*后一步是尋找保護熔絲的位置并將保護熔絲暴露在紫外光下。一般用一臺放大倍數至少100倍的顯微鏡,從編程電壓輸入腳的連線跟蹤進去,
來尋找保護熔絲。若沒有顯微鏡,則采用將芯片的不同部分暴露到紫外光下并觀察結果的方式進行簡單的搜索。操作時應用不透明的紙片覆蓋芯片以
保護程序存儲器不被紫外光擦除。將保護熔絲暴露在紫外光下5~10分鐘就能破壞掉保護位的保護作用,之后,使用簡單的編程器就可直接讀出程序存
儲器的內容。
對于使用了防護層來保護EEPROM單元的單片機來說,使用紫外光復位保護電路是不可行的。對于這種類型的單片機,一般使用微探針技術來讀取
存儲器內容。在芯片封裝打開后,將芯片置于顯微鏡下就能夠很容易的找到從存儲器連到電路其它部分的數據總線。由于某種原因,芯片鎖定位在編
程模式下并不鎖定對存儲器的訪問。利用這一缺陷將探針放在數據線的上面就能讀到所有想要的數據。在編程模式下,重啟讀過程并連接探針到另外
的數據線上就可以讀出程序和數據存儲器中的所有信息。
芯片解密
芯片解密又稱為單片機解密(IC解密),由于正式產品中的單片機芯片都加密了,直接使用編程器是不能讀出程序的。但有時候客戶由于一些原因,
需要得到單片機內部的程序,用來參考研究學習、找到丟失的資料或復制一些芯片,這就需要做芯片解密了。芯片解密就是通過一定的設備和方法,
直接得到加密了的單片機中的燒寫文件,可以自己復制燒寫芯片或反匯編后自己參考研究。 |
|